Writing Clean Code for Robust and Scalable Mobile Applications

Clean code is the cornerstone of any successful mobile application. It ensures that your app is not only operational but also stable and capable of scaling as user demand increases. When writing code for mobile apps, it's crucial to prioritize clarity, readability, and maintainability.

Follow these best practices to develop clean code that will remain relevant:

* Utilize descriptive variable and function names.

* Arrange your code into logical modules or components.

* Document your code to explain complex logic or choices.

* Adhere to coding conventions and style guides.

* Develop unit tests to ensure the accuracy of your code.

By integrating these principles, you can construct robust and scalable mobile applications that are a joy to enhance.

Streamlining Mobile Delivery: The Power of Continuous Integration & Delivery

In today's fast-paced market, delivering high-grade- mobile applications swiftly are crucial for success. Continuous Integration & Delivery (CI/CD) emerges as a powerful strategy to achieve this agility. Through automated processes, CI/CD streamlines the development lifecycle, enabling frequent and reliable updates. Developers can merge code changes seamlessly, ensuring a stable and robust application foundation. Automated testing throughout the pipeline uncovers potential issues early on, reducing any risk of deployment bugs. This iterative approach allows for rapid feedback loops, accelerating development cycles and enabling teams to deliver value to users more quickly.

A robust CI/CD pipeline incorporates several key stages. First, developers push their code changes to a shared repository. Then, automated builds assemble the application from the committed code. These builds are subsequently tested by a suite of automated tests. Upon successful testing, the application is ready for deployment to testing environments. Finally, continuous delivery facilitates the release process, ensuring that applications are made available to users in a timely and reliable manner.

By embracing CI/CD, mobile development teams can achieve unparalleled efficiency and scalability.
